Я использую TestNG для настройки своих тестов и использую ReportNG для отчетов.
Настройка кода
У меня есть класс, у которого есть провайдер данных TestNG, для которого настроено параллельное = true, и для каждого элемента, который предоставляет провайдер данных, создаются разные потоки (число потоков настраивается) для запуска @ Test
Вопрос
Результат reportNG выглядит красиво и выглядит примерно так в html
MyTestName 0.297s Аргументы метода: "URL1"
MyTestName 0.156s Аргументы метода: "URL2"
Исходя из логики в моем @Test MyTestName, я хотел бы пропустить / не выполнить @Test и распечатать сообщения, которые появятся в отчете ReportNG. Как бы я сделал это, что будет потокобезопасным? Кто-нибудь может указать мне на примеры?
Спасибо!